Irish American actor, comedian, writer and director. He worked as a stand-up comic and achieved some notoriety for his acerbic take on American life. Appeared as the lead in the FX fireman hit, ‘Rescue Me,’ for which he was nominated for a Golden Globe. Founded the Leary Firefighters’ Foundation charity in response to the Dec. 3, 1999 warehouse fire that killed six firefighters in his hometown of Worcester, MA. His cousin Jeremiah Lucey was among the six heroic firefighters killed. Leary also established a second division of LFFF, the Leary Firefighters’ Foundation Fund for New York’s Bravest in response to the FDNY’s losses in the Sept. 11th attacks.
